Sivananda Yoga- A Step Closer To God
If you thought that yoga was all about fitness, then may be its time you should give it a second thought. Yoga is not just all about fitness. Instead it is way of living that aims at both physical and emotional well being. Sivananda yoga is one such form of yoga that is not just about poses and physical practice. Founded by Swami Sivananda, this yoga exercise will help you be at peace with yourself.

While all yoga forms make use of the five basic yoga principles, the Sivananda yoga stresses on these principles more than others. These include proper exercise, proper breathing, proper diet and positive thinking. Proper exercising refers to performing the yoga postures which are unchanged from other forms of yoga. Yoga exercises such as pranayama teach you proper breathing. And proper diet implies a completely vegetarian diet.

Unlike other yoga exercises and forms, the Sivananda yoga lays down four paths. These are karma yoga, Bhakti yoga, raja yoga and Jnana yoga. Let us know each of these one by one. The first path i.e. karma yoga states the path of action. As per karma yoga, you should clean the heart to keep it free from any negative or ill feelings. Also you are asked to act selflessly so that you ad others around you too can benefit. Writing and reciting mantras will help you follow this path.

The bhakti yoga or the path of devotion asks you to transforming your emotion into unconditional love. This path treads its route to God, the ultimate being and thus aims at spiritual well being. To follow this path you should chant, sing, pray and worship making you calmer soul. By following this path you shall be one step closer to God.

Mental energy can be more powerful than even the strongest of physical energy. The third path or the raja yoga asks you to use this mental energy in a positive form. Your thoughts, the physical energy of your body and your emotions are routed in a positive direction. To incline your mind and body towards the positive front, meditation and relaxation exercises are practiced.

Knowledge is power and this is why the Sivananda yoga specifies the last path as the path to seek knowledge or jnana yoga. This path specifies you to ask and inculcate your knowledge about things around, your spiritual and emotional well being.
